Output 65e80aa6eccd61f8e9ea2d0c2c1c5406c779aa36eb3b3caa85a246e871148902:0

value
520013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aca20861105ee0b85755d197848a76906aea107 OP_EQUAL
address
3HG4wBsb4YAiaehqAk5MGJFa6jjKdqFpwc
transaction
65e80aa6eccd61f8e9ea2d0c2c1c5406c779aa36eb3b3caa85a246e871148902
spent
true